Quick contact to you Speed Contact Bar enables your visitors to get in contact with you quickly. The plugin shows a colored bar with your contact data and social media URLs on the top of every page of your website. The bar design is responsive and thus ready for smartphones and tablets. The social media icons are included already. Each icon appears if you set its target URL in the option page. The phone icons and numbers are clickable to trigger a phone call. SMTP (Simple Mail Transfer Protocol) is an industry-standard for sending emails. Proper SMTP configuration helps increase email deliverability by adding authentication to the emails sent from your site. Popular email clients like Gmail, Yahoo, Office 365, and Zoho are in a constant battle with email spammers, so they check whether emails are originating from a genuine sender. If the proper authentication isn’t there, emails either go in the SPAM folder or, worse, disappear. This is a problem for a lot of WordPress sites. By default, WordPress uses the PHP mail function to send emails generated by WordPress or any contact form plugin like WPForms. But most WordPress hosting companies don’t have their servers properly configured for sending PHP emails. This is why WordPress emails aren’t delivered. How does WP Mail SMTP work? WP Mail SMTP plugin easily resolves email delivery problems by changing the way your WordPress site sends email. We reconfigure the wp_mail() function to use proper SMTP host credentials or an SMTP mail provider. With our built-in SMTP mail provider integrations (recommended), emails are sent using the provider’s direct API. Even if your web host is blocking SMTP ports, your emails will still be sent successfully. This helps you fix all WordPress not sending email issues.
